3. ZoomInfo
3
ZoomInfo 4.4/5
Best for: Enterprise sales orgs that monetize intent data, org charts and direct dials.
ZoomInfo is the enterprise standard: best-in-class firmographic data, intent signals and org charts. It is also priced like enterprise software, with contracts starting around $15,000 a year and procurement cycles to match.
PROS
Best-in-class data depth and intent
Org charts and direct dials
Enterprise-grade platform
CONS
$15K+/yr contracts
Sales calls and procurement to start
Overkill and overpriced for SMB

4. Hunter.io
4
Hunter.io 4.4/5
Best for: Finding email patterns for a specific domain you already know.
Hunter is excellent at one job: domain email search. Give it a company and it returns likely addresses and the pattern. It is weak as a full prospecting tool because it cannot search a large database by persona or send at scale.
PROS
Best-in-class domain email search
Simple and fast for single lookups
Free tier to start
CONS
Domain-only, no persona search
Credit-metered verification
No real sending or warm-up

5. Snov.io
5
Snov.io 4.5/5
Best for: Budget teams wanting finding, verification and sending in one credit-based bundle.
Snov bundles a lead finder, verifier and sender at an accessible price. The friction is the shared credit pool: finding, verifying and enriching all draw from the same credits, so a heavy month in one area starves the others.
PROS
Finder, verifier and sender bundled
Chrome extension finder
Low entry price
CONS
Shared credit pool forces trade-offs
Warm-up costs extra per inbox
Recipient caps per tier

6. Smartlead
6
Smartlead 4.6/5
Best for: Technical agencies needing unlimited mailboxes, a deep API and white-label sending.
Smartlead is the sender's sender: unlimited mailbox rotation, a mature API and white-label options. But it brings no lead data and no verification, so a real setup means Smartlead plus a database plus a verifier.
PROS
Unlimited mailboxes on all plans
Powerful API and white label
Strong warm-up and rotation
CONS
No native lead database
No built-in verification
Steeper learning curve

Are B2B lead generation tools legal?
Processing public business contact data for relevant B2B outreach is generally legal under CAN-SPAM and GDPR legitimate interest, provided you honor opt-outs.
